How much does it cost to rent an apartment in South Peninsula?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| South Peninsula Studio Apartments | $1,733 | $900 | $4,301 |
| South Peninsula 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,889 | $900 | $6,712 |
| South Peninsula 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,260 | $700 | $9,749 |
| South Peninsula 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,407 | $1,200 | $10,000+ |
| South Peninsula 4 Bedroom Apartments | $13,443 | $2,350 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about South Peninsula
What is the current pricing and availability for apartments for rent in the South Peninsula area of Saint Petersburg, FL?
As of today, August 25, 2026, there are currently 1,766 available South Peninsula apartments priced from $700 to $32,614, with an average monthly rent of $2,168.
How much are Studio apartments in South Peninsula?
There are currently 656 Studio Apartments in South Peninsula with rent ranges from $900 to $4,301 with an average price of $1,733.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om South Peninsula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in South Peninsula ranges from $900 to $6,712 with an average monthly rent of $1,889.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in South Peninsula c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in South Peninsula range from $700 to $9,749.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,260.
How expensive are South Peninsula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 196 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in South Peninsula on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,200 to $28,487 - averaging $3,407 for the location.
